European Canoeing Association Freestyle Rules 2006

Appendix 2 - Surface Boat - Variety Moves List

 

printer-version

 

 

 

 

 

 

Move

Description

Scored

Value

 

Ender

One vertical end over 70 degrees performed facing directly upstream or downstream. ( Part of a loop. Not half a cartwheel )

FB

 

 

Pirouette

Single stroke 360-degree rotation at an elevation greater than 70 degrees, on the bow or stern retaining the feature.

RL

 

Flat spin

360-degree rotation of the boat at a 0-45 degree angle.

RL

 

 

Clean spin

360-degree rotation of the boat with one stroke at a 0-45 degree angle.

RL

 

 

Super clean spin

360-degree rotation of the boat with no strokes at a 0-45 degree angle.

RL

 

 

Shuvit

Two consecutive 180 degree rotations in opposite directions at a 0-45 degree angle. ( or a low angle split wheel )

RL

 

 

Round house

Elevated 180 degrees rotation on green water at an angle less than 45 degrees, clear of the foam pile, where the competitor rotates around the bow of the boat landing in a back surf.

RL

 

 

Clean round house

Elevated 180 degrees rotation on green water at an angle less than 45 degrees, clear of the foam pile, where the competitor rotates around the bow of the boat landing in a back surf with no paddle stroke.

RL

 

 

Back round house

Elevated 180 degrees rotation on green water at an angle less than 45 degrees, clear of the foam pile, where the competitor rotates around the stern of the boat, landing in a front surf.

RL

 

 

Clean back round house

Elevated 180 degrees rotation on green water at an angle less than 45 degrees, clear of the foam pile, where the competitor rotates around the stern of the boat, landing in a front surf, with no paddle stroke.

RL

 

Blunt

Elevated 180 degrees rotation on green water at an angle greater than 45 degrees, clear of the foam pile, where the competitor rotates around the bow of the boat, landing in a back surf.

RL

Clean blunt

Elevated 180 degrees rotation on green water at an angle greater than 45 degrees, clear of the foam pile, where the competitor rotates around the bow of the boat, landing in a back surf, with no paddle stroke.

RL

Cart wheel

Two consecutive ends in the same rotational direction, with both ends at an angle greater than 45 degrees.

RL

Splitwheel

Two consecutive ends, with a change of direction in between each. One end of more than 45 degrees, and one with more than 70 degrees.

RL

Felix

A 360 degree spin / roll combination where at least 180 degrees of the rotation is inverted. The move must be completed to an upright surfing position on the feature. (Basically a non aerial Helix).

Tricky woo

A three ended sequence - two ends must be over 70 degrees and the other over 45 degrees. The entire sequence is performed using one paddle blade only. The first end is initiated on the bow one way. The second tail end is split back and rotated through 180 degrees. The third bow end is followed through in the same direction as the first landing back in the feature.

Mc Nasty

Starting in a back blast, the boat is bounced, inverted and the stern thrown into the green water. The boat half loops back upright so the paddler finishes the move facing upstream.

Loop

Two consecutive ends over 70 degrees where the boat remains facing the direction of the water flow, starting and finishing facing upstream.

F

Helix

A 360 degree spin / roll combination with at least 180 degrees performed inverted. The competitor’s head and shoulders may contact the water, but the boat must be aerial through the inverted 180 degrees part of the move. The move must be completed to an upright surfing position on the wave.

Huge Bonus

Awarded when any move gets huge clearly visible air where the boat, paddle and body including head are at least 1ft / 30cm above the water.

Kick Flip Entry**

An entry move when the boat enters the feature and gets aerial from the peak of the pile. Barrel rolling, landing and retaining the feature. Boat and body must be clear of the feature for 180 degrees (inverted part) of the barrel roll.
